cmt-0.5.0.0: src/Cmt/IO/Input.hs
{-# LANGUAGE NoImplicitPrelude #-}
{-# LANGUAGE OverloadedStrings #-}
{-# LANGUAGE OverloadedLists #-}
module Cmt.IO.Input
( loop
) where
import ClassyPrelude
import Data.Map.Strict (Map)
import System.Console.Terminal.Size (size, width)
import Cmt.IO.Git (changed)
import Cmt.Parser.Options (parse)
import Cmt.Types.Config
type Choice = Map Int Text
prompt :: Text -> IO Text
prompt s = do
putStr $ s <> " "
hFlush stdout
getLine
getWidth :: IO Int
getWidth = maybe 0 width <$> size
putName :: Text -> IO ()
putName name = putStrLn $ "\n" <> name <> ":"
listItem :: Int -> Text -> Text
listItem n o = tshow n <> ") " <> o
displayOptions :: Choice -> IO ()
displayOptions opts = do
let parts = mapWithKey listItem opts
let long = intercalate " " parts
maxLength <- getWidth
if length long < maxLength
then putStrLn long
else sequence_ $ putStrLn <$> parts
choice :: Choice -> Int -> Maybe Text
choice opts chosen = lookup chosen opts
choiceGen :: [Text] -> Choice
choiceGen ts = mapFromList $ zip [1 ..] ts
options :: [Text] -> IO Text
options opts = do
let opts' = choiceGen opts
displayOptions opts'
chosen <- parse <$> prompt ">"
case chosen of
Nothing -> options opts
Just chosen' -> do
let picked = catMaybes $ choice opts' <$> chosen'
if null picked
then options opts
else pure $ intercalate ", " picked
multiLine :: [Text] -> IO [Text]
multiLine input = do
value <- prompt ">"
if null value && not (null input)
then pure input
else multiLine $ input ++ [value]
line :: IO Text
line = do
value <- prompt ">"
if null value
then line
else pure value
output :: Part -> IO Output
output (Part name Line) = putName name >> (,) name <$> line
output (Part name (Options opts)) = putName name >> (,) name <$> options opts
output (Part name Lines) = putName name >> (,) name <$> (unlines <$> multiLine [])
output (Part name Changed) = putName name >> (,) name <$> (options =<< changed)
loop :: Config -> IO Outputs
loop (Config parts _) = mapFromList <$> traverse output parts
